Springville, UT (PRWEB)
Digital Technology International (DTI) has signed an agreement with Sun-Times Media, a Wrapports company, to deploy a new circulation and audience engagement solution via DTI Cloud, the company’s award-winning cloud environment. This large-scale deployment marks a major expansion of Digital Technology cloud-based solutions at Sun-Times Media.
Sun-Times Media serves more than 300 communities across the greater Chicago region with media properties including the flagship, the Chicago Sun-Times.
Along with strong marketing and audience management tools, Sun-Times Media needed a unified circulation system for the group’s end-to-end operations. They also wanted the same cost-efficient DTI Cloud platform for circulation that they have with their DTI editorial software. DTI Circulation is a powerful solution for Sun-Times Media that will manage and package all subscription data—digital and print—as audience demand grows for new digital channels.
“We wanted to avoid the costs associated with an on-premises system—like resources, infrastructure, etc. And, we wanted a mechanism to keep pace with where the technology is going,” said Jeff Kane, vice president, technology, Sun-Times Media. “Our successful implementation (of DTI ContentPublisher) led us back to DTI Cloud since we are applying a similar concept to circulation.”
Sun-Times Media has the largest DTI ContentPublisher deployment via DTI Cloud.
Each day, Sun-Times Media distributes the news to more than 300 communities across Illinois and into Indiana, including Chicago’s top circulated newspaper, the Chicago Sun-Times. The Chicago Sun-Times is also the ninth-circulated newspaper in the country.
With growing digital and print publications and applications (apps) in the works, Sun-Times Media’s current environment, which includes multiple publications with legacy circulation apps on multiple platforms, has made it difficult from a reporting and product packaging standpoint. DTI Circulation is a technology-driven solution that gives Sun-Times Media the ability to package print and digital products in flexible combinations and bundles.
PCI compliance—the safeguarding of customers’ payment card data—was imperative for Sun-Times Media.
Kane states, “PCI compliance was a critical component to our vendor selection decision. We wanted a vendor that had the experience and knowledge to ensure we were not open to any credit card data security issues. The methodology DTI uses protects us from this and complies with the current PCI standards.”

In addition to the Chicago Sun-Times, Sun-Times Media includes Suntimes.com; seven suburban daily newspapers, including the Beacon-News (Aurora, Ill.), Courier-News (Elgin, Ill.), Herald-News (Joliet, Ill.), Lake County News-Sun (Waukegan, Ill.), Post-Tribune (Merrillville, Ind.) and the SouthtownStar (Tinley Park, Ill.); 32 weekly Pioneer products, as well as websites for those newspapers, centerstagechicago.com, RogerEbert.com, SearchChicago.com and YourSeason.com.
